Output dd11ff317a6ecae4c7c815f0ef84a959cb196c511f96b7d9906175dc607a07dd:72

value
22877000
script pubkey
OP_0 OP_PUSHBYTES_20 ecd09bd17d1d035089a2b3f191d03e3501600b97
address
bc1qangfh5tar5p4pzdzk0cer5p7x5qkqzuhh03cs6
transaction
dd11ff317a6ecae4c7c815f0ef84a959cb196c511f96b7d9906175dc607a07dd